What's the best time of year to travel to Yumoto with my pet?
When you’re travelling with pets, keeping tabs on the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 0°C. The rainiest months in Yumoto are July, September, August and June, with each month seeing an average of 252 mm of rainf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Yumoto?
Known for its natural beauty, Yumoto has lots to offer visitors, including its mountains, skiing and monuments. See the local sights and visit Onsenjinjya Shrine and Mount Chausudake. While you’re there, make sure you don’t miss Mt. Jeans Ski Resort and Fujishiro Seiji Museum.
